Ilorin — The former Chief Judge of Kwara State, Justice Raliat Elelu-Habeeb last Thurs-day forcefully staged a come back to her former office by breaking the entrance door two days after a new acting Chief Judge was sworn-in.
Justice Elelu-Habeeb, whose tenure as CJ came to an end on Tuesday after the State House of Assembly approved a request through a letter sent by the State Governor, Dr Bukola Saraki , seeking her removal from office over allegations of gross misconduct .
